Gavin Edwards continued to write songs and perform with Franklin in top venues across Ireland, such as Oxegen, Michelstown and O2 in The Park to over 120 000 people .A huge coup for Gavin and the boys was the opportunity to support Incubus in The Point Depot.

Gavin left Franklin in October 2007 to purse a new solo project. Gavin decided to hit the road running and start writing the songs for the upcoming debut album. The past years have taken Gavin all over the world from Dublin to London , New York ,Nashville and L.A and finally down under to Australia.

Gavin Edwards had the great privilege to write alongside some of the biggest names in the industry from Billy Mann (Pink!), David Schuler (Pink!) , Phil Thornalle (Natalie Imbruglia) just to name a few, and had 2 co-writes , ‘Here In My Arms” and “Mirrors” with David Schuler for his band The Sunstreaks.

Gavin Edwards is an accomplished, professional singer/songwriter from South Africa. Gavin moved over to Ireland with his band (Franklin) in 2002 by request of ex- Westlife star, Brian McFadden, who saw them perform in a holiday resort while on honeymoon in South Africa. Brian was so impressed with what he saw, that he immediately signed them to his own management and record label in Ireland, which resulted in an Irish Top 20 hit for Gavin and the band in 2004.

Before Franklin, Gavin was frontman for the band Allegory, who had a massive following at popular nightclubs, Roxy Rhythm Bar and Trader Horns in the late nineties and early 2000s.

Gavin has also had the great privilege to play live sessions for Brian Mcfadden on numerous occasions including Australia’s Got Talent and Sunrise in Australia, as well as for Enrique Iglesias for the Child Line concert in Dublin .

Gavin released a single in 2011 through Village Roadshow in Australia which was featured on Dancing With The Stars and got to No 88 on the Australian iTunes Chart.

Gavin entered the first season of X-Factor in South Africa in 2014 and made it to Top 7 of the show but got his biggest break when he decided to enter The Voice. His touching story, his talent and his passion earned him the title of runner-up on the show. Now, having signed a lucrative deal with Universal Music South Africa, Gavin is in studio recording his next record and looks forward to reaching the masses with his original music as well as personal, familiar favourites.
